pHM-GM-CSF is an investigational **bicistronic plasmid DNA cancer vaccine** encoding a truncated human epidermal growth factor receptor 2 antigen and granulocyte-macrophage colony-stimulating factor. Intramuscular administration is intended to induce HER2-directed cellular and humoral antitumor immunity while locally expressed GM-CSF enhances antigen presentation and immune priming. It was evaluated as the DNA-prime component of a heterologous pHM-GM-CSF/Ad-HM prime-boost regimen in patients with HER2-expressing stage III-IV metastatic breast cancer; the phase 1 study reported mainly grade 1 toxicities and no serious drug-related adverse events.
